    What Makes a Great Orthopedic Spine Surgeon?

    When you're looking for the best orthopedic spine doctor, there are several key factors to consider. It's not just about finding someone with a medical degree; it's about finding a specialist with the right combination of skills, experience, and patient care philosophy. Let's break down some of the essential qualities:

    • Extensive Experience: Experience is paramount in the medical field, especially in surgery. A surgeon who has performed numerous spine surgeries is likely to have encountered a wide range of cases and complications. This experience equips them with the knowledge and skills to handle complex situations effectively. Look for surgeons who have a track record of successful outcomes and positive patient testimonials.
    • Specialized Training: Orthopedic spine surgery is a highly specialized field. The best spine surgeons have completed fellowships or advanced training specifically focused on spine surgery. This specialized training ensures they are up-to-date with the latest techniques and technologies in the field. They should be experts in both surgical and non-surgical treatments for spinal conditions.
    • Board Certification: Board certification is a significant indicator of a surgeon's competence and expertise. It means the surgeon has met rigorous standards set by a professional medical board. Board-certified spine surgeons have passed comprehensive examinations and demonstrated a high level of skill in their specialty. Always verify that your surgeon is board-certified in orthopedic surgery or neurosurgery with a subspecialty in spine surgery.
    • Use of Advanced Technology: The field of spine surgery is constantly evolving, with new technologies and techniques emerging regularly. The best orthopedic spine surgeons embrace these advancements to improve patient outcomes. This includes using minimally invasive surgical techniques, computer-assisted surgery, and advanced imaging technologies. Minimally invasive procedures often result in less pain, smaller incisions, and faster recovery times.
    • Comprehensive Approach to Care: A top spine surgeon doesn't just focus on the surgical procedure itself. They take a comprehensive approach to patient care, which includes a thorough evaluation, accurate diagnosis, personalized treatment plans, and post-operative care. They should be able to explain your condition clearly, discuss all treatment options (both surgical and non-surgical), and involve you in the decision-making process.
    • Excellent Communication Skills: Effective communication is crucial for a positive patient-surgeon relationship. The best doctors are those who can listen to your concerns, answer your questions thoroughly, and explain complex medical information in a way that you can understand. They should be empathetic and supportive, making you feel comfortable and confident in their care.
    • Reputation and Reviews: It's always a good idea to research a surgeon's reputation and read reviews from previous patients. Online reviews, testimonials, and ratings can provide valuable insights into the surgeon's skills, bedside manner, and overall patient experience. You can also ask for referrals from your primary care physician or other specialists.
    • Hospital Affiliations: The hospital where a surgeon practices can also be an indicator of their quality. Top spine surgeons often have affiliations with reputable hospitals and medical centers that have state-of-the-art facilities and a multidisciplinary team of healthcare professionals. These hospitals typically have higher standards of care and better patient outcomes.

    How to Find the Right Surgeon for You

    Finding the right orthopedic spine surgeon can feel like a daunting task, but it's a crucial step in ensuring you receive the best possible care. Guys, let's break down the process into manageable steps to help you make an informed decision.

    1. Consult Your Primary Care Physician: Start by discussing your condition with your primary care physician. They can provide an initial evaluation, order necessary tests, and refer you to a qualified orthopedic spine surgeon. Your primary care physician's recommendation can be a valuable starting point in your search.
    2. Get Referrals: Ask your primary care physician, friends, family, or other healthcare professionals for referrals. Personal recommendations can provide valuable insights into a surgeon's skills and bedside manner. It's always helpful to hear about other people's experiences with a particular surgeon.
    3. Research and Verify Credentials: Once you have a list of potential surgeons, do your research. Verify their credentials, including board certification, education, and training. You can typically find this information on the surgeon's website or the hospital's website. Make sure the surgeon is board-certified in orthopedic surgery or neurosurgery with a subspecialty in spine surgery.
    4. Check Experience and Specialization: Look for a surgeon who has extensive experience in treating your specific condition. Spine surgery is a broad field, and surgeons may specialize in different areas, such as minimally invasive surgery, spinal deformity correction, or pediatric spine surgery. Choose a surgeon whose expertise aligns with your needs.
    5. Read Reviews and Testimonials: Online reviews and testimonials can provide valuable insights into a surgeon's skills, patient care approach, and overall patient experience. Look for reviews on reputable websites and pay attention to both positive and negative feedback. Keep in mind that every patient's experience is unique, but reviews can help you get a general sense of a surgeon's reputation.
    6. Schedule Consultations: Schedule consultations with several surgeons to discuss your condition and treatment options. This is an opportunity to ask questions, get a thorough evaluation, and assess the surgeon's communication style. A good surgeon will take the time to listen to your concerns, explain your diagnosis clearly, and discuss all available treatment options.
    7. Ask Questions: During the consultation, don't hesitate to ask questions. Here are some questions you might want to consider:
      • What is your experience treating my specific condition?
      • What are the potential risks and benefits of surgery?
      • What is the recovery process like?
      • What are the alternatives to surgery?
      • What is your success rate for this type of surgery?
      • What is your approach to pain management?
    8. Evaluate Communication Style: Pay attention to the surgeon's communication style. Do they explain things clearly and in a way that you can understand? Do they listen to your concerns and answer your questions thoroughly? A good surgeon will be patient, empathetic, and willing to involve you in the decision-making process.
    9. Consider Hospital Affiliations: The hospital where a surgeon practices can also be an indicator of their quality. Top spine surgeons often have affiliations with reputable hospitals and medical centers that have state-of-the-art facilities and a multidisciplinary team of healthcare professionals. These hospitals typically have higher standards of care and better patient outcomes.
    10. Trust Your Gut: Ultimately, the decision of who to choose as your surgeon is a personal one. Trust your instincts and choose a surgeon with whom you feel comfortable and confident. You should feel that the surgeon understands your concerns, has the expertise to treat your condition, and is committed to providing you with the best possible care.

    Preparing for Your Consultation

    Preparing for your consultation with an orthopedic spine surgeon is essential to ensure you get the most out of your appointment. It helps you gather all the necessary information and ask the right questions so you can make informed decisions about your treatment. Let's walk through how to prepare effectively.

    • Gather Your Medical Records: Before your consultation, collect all relevant medical records, including previous doctor's notes, imaging reports (such as X-rays, MRIs, and CT scans), and any other test results. Having these records readily available will help the surgeon understand your medical history and the progression of your condition. Organize these documents in a clear and chronological order to make it easier for the surgeon to review them.
    • List Your Symptoms: Write down all your symptoms, including when they started, how often they occur, and what makes them better or worse. Be as detailed as possible. This information will help the surgeon understand the nature and severity of your condition. Include any pain, numbness, weakness, or other sensations you're experiencing.
    • Note Your Medical History: Prepare a detailed medical history, including any previous illnesses, surgeries, and current medications. Include any allergies you have and any adverse reactions you've experienced with medications. This information is crucial for the surgeon to assess your overall health and identify any potential risks or complications.
    • List Your Questions: Write down all the questions you want to ask the surgeon. It's easy to forget questions during the appointment, so having a list ensures you cover everything important to you. Some questions you might consider include:
      • What is the diagnosis?
      • What are the treatment options?
      • What are the risks and benefits of each treatment?
      • What is the surgeon's experience with my condition?
      • What is the recovery process like?
      • What are the alternatives to surgery?
    • Bring a Support Person: If possible, bring a family member or friend with you to the consultation. They can provide support, take notes, and help you remember important information. Having another person present can also help you feel more comfortable and confident during the appointment.
    • Prepare to Describe Your Lifestyle: Be ready to discuss your lifestyle, including your daily activities, work habits, and exercise routine. This information will help the surgeon understand how your condition affects your daily life and what your goals are for treatment. For example, if you're an athlete, your treatment plan may differ from someone with a sedentary lifestyle.
    • Research Your Condition: Before your appointment, do some research on your condition. Understanding the basics of your condition can help you ask more informed questions and have a more productive discussion with the surgeon. However, be sure to rely on reputable sources and avoid self-diagnosing based on online information.
    • Consider Your Goals: Think about what you hope to achieve with treatment. Are you looking for pain relief, improved mobility, or a return to your previous level of activity? Sharing your goals with the surgeon will help them develop a treatment plan that aligns with your expectations.
